How many of you have a Diablo and an Automatic with raised shift points? I get these wild low 4, high 3 second results because when it hits second gear, it breaks the tires loose and the wheel speed hits 60. I see the timer stop then when the tires stop spinning its back down in the 50s on the digital speed readout below the timer. In other words, the raised shift points and the Diablo make it nearly impossible to get an actual 0-60. I guess I could try lowering the shift points which would lower the MPH when it shifts into second which in turn might lower the wheel speed on the 2nd gear wheel spin below 60...

Anyone else have this? It is an 08, so maybe that crappy open diff is part of the problem, but it usually slides a bit to the right ( which means both rears are spinning)
